스마트폰 과의존이 대학생활 적응에 미치는 요인분석
Factor Analysis of the Effects of Smartphone Overdependence on University Students’ Adaptation to College Life

Objectives: This study targeted dental hygiene students to confirm the influence of subjective happiness and smartphone overdependence on college life adaptation. Methods: The research subjects consisted of 217 dental hygiene students. The data were collected from October 1 to 15, 2024. The data were subjected to a t-test, ANOVA, Pearson’s correlation analysis, and multiple regression analysis using SPSS 20.0. Results: The results showed the factors affecting dental hygiene students’ college life adaptation in the following order: subjective happiness (β = .366, p <.001), academic major satisfaction (β = .351, p <.001), and smartphone overdependence (β = .366, p <.001). The total explanatory power of these variables accounted for 85.099%. Conclusions: Subjective happiness, smartphone overdependence, and academic major satisfaction were identified as influential factors on the college life adaptation of dental hygiene students. Accordingly, it is necessary to develop and operate a program for promoting subjective happiness, strengthening academic major satisfaction, and preventing smartphone overdependence to enhance adjustment to college life.
